如何消除CSS中ul的自帶間距?
在CSS中,ul元素自帶間距是因?yàn)闉g覽器默認(rèn)會(huì)給li元素添加一些樣式,包括間距,為了消除這個(gè)間距,我們可以使用CSS的樣式重置功能或者給ul元素添加一些自定義樣式。
下面是一些消除ul自帶間距的方法:
1、使用CSS重置樣式
我們可以使用CSS重置樣式來(lái)消除ul的自帶間距,在CSS中添加以下代碼:
ul { list-style: none; margin: 0; padding: 0; }
這段代碼中,list-style: none;
表示消除ul的列表樣式,margin: 0;
和padding: 0;
表示消除ul的上邊距和左邊距,這樣,ul的自帶間距就會(huì)被消除了。
2、使用自定義樣式
除了使用CSS重置樣式外,我們還可以給ul元素添加一些自定義樣式來(lái)消除間距,在CSS中添加以下代碼:
ul { margin-top: -10px; /* 消除上邊距 */ margin-left: -10px; /* 消除左邊距 */ }
這段代碼中,margin-top: -10px;
和margin-left: -10px;
表示給ul的上邊距和左邊距添加負(fù)值,從而消除間距,這種方法也可以達(dá)到消除ul自帶間距的效果。
消除CSS中ul的自帶間距可以通過(guò)使用CSS重置樣式或自定義樣式來(lái)實(shí)現(xiàn),根據(jù)具體的需求和情況,我們可以選擇適合自己的方法。